Maybe: We usually do not use estrogen and Progesterone to help you get pregnant. These may be to get a menses before medication for ovulation induction (to get you to ovulate). Most pcos women respond to medication. See a specialist to get the best advice - the doctor who gave you e & p should be able to explain what they are doing.
